PAGNOTTI v. STATE

No. 4D00-4747.

821 So.2d 466 (2002)

Domenick PAGNOTTI, Appellant, v. ST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fourth District.

July 24, 2002.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Carey Haughwout, Public Defender, and Louis G. Carres, Assistant Public Defender, West Palm Beach, for appellant.

Robert A. Butterworth, Attorney General, Tallahassee, and Consuelo Maingot, Assistant Attorney General, Fort Lauderdale, for appellee.


HAZOURI, J.

Domenick Pagnotti pled guilty to two counts of sexual activity with a child (counts I and II), sexual activity solicitation (count III) and two counts of indecent assault (counts IV and V). He was sentenced on April 29, 1993, to nine years in prison followed by five years probation on counts I, II, IV and V, and to five years in prison on count III, all counts to be served concurrently with credit for time served.
